- The distance between Sennar, Sudan and Greensburg, Ky, Usa is approximately 11,569 km or 7,189 mi.
- To reach Sennar in this distance one would set out from Greensburg, Ky bearing 60.6°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Sennar bearing 134.3° or SE .
- Sennar has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Greensburg, Ky has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Sennar is in or near the tropical thorn woodland biome whereas Greensburg, Ky is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 15.3 °C (27.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.9 °C (28.6°F) less in Sennar.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 922.6 mm (36.3 in) less which is equivalent to 922.6 l/m² (22.64 US gal/ft²) or 9,226,000 l/ha (986,321 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.4° higher in Sennar than in Greensburg, Ky.
